TENDERS SHEEP AND DAIRY LANDS FOR SALE. 'T'ENDERS ARE INVITED by the Public Trustee for the purchase (as a whole - L or iu one or more lots) of four attractive freehold farm sections at Mahara* liara, Woodville County containing 358, 209, 197 and 314 acres respectively. Land well watered, fences well maintained, pastures in excellent order, all cleared. About 7 miles from Woodville and Maharahara rail stations. Access by good metalled roads. Dwellings and farm buildings on all except 197 acre section. Condition and form of tender available at Public Trust Office, Auckland, Dannevirke, Hamilton, Hastings, Masterton, Napier, Pahiatua, Palmerston North, Waipukurau, Wanganui, Wellington and Woodville. TENDERS, marked “Estate of J. D. Galloway,”- close at the Public Trust Office, Dannevirke, at 4 p.m. on Ist. February, 1937. W. J. FORSYTH, District Public Trustee for Dannevirke.
